Output 8c539f4d6a024a5b15ffa7bd73f599a187d8863ba40454de7d4924ca670c50cd:0

value
1520484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c03fef1f5359a04b10cc91f5b3832e46353c9d OP_EQUAL
address
3N66v4ukQZ2EcuuaKP5i5oSF2PCbhjMMuT
transaction
8c539f4d6a024a5b15ffa7bd73f599a187d8863ba40454de7d4924ca670c50cd
spent
true